An FIR has been registered by the vigilance unit of Delhi Police against an inspector and a head constable posted with the Intelligence Fusion and Strategic Operations unit of the special cell on allegations of bribery, extortion, assault and misuse of official position. The case was registered on May 15 following a complaint filed against inspector Uday Singh and head constable Robin by a man accused in a cyber fraud case. He alleged that on July 15, 2024, he was handcuffed in public view in Rohini and taken to his house by the cops. They assaulted him, misbehaved with his wife and threatened the family during a search operation, he claimed. The policemen allegedly seized Rs 20 lakh, a mangalsutra and other valuables, and also used his credit card while he was lodged in jail. They forced his wife to pay Rs 15 lakh and Robin also demanded a car for Singh, he claimed.
